Title IX expert Janet Judge brought her knowledge and experience to the AMCC in a pair of presentations to conference member administrators, coaches, athletic trainers, SIDs, FARs, and Title IX officers in November.
Judge met with representatives from Hilbert College, Medaille College, D'Youville College, Pitt-Bradford, Penn St. Behrend and Alfred State College in Western New York, then travelled to Western Pennsylvania to work with staff from La Roche University, Pitt-Greensburg, Mount Aloysius College, Penn St. Altoona and Franciscan University. Approximately 150 AMCC staff members took part.
"No one educates on Title IX in college athletics better than Janet Judge," said AMCC Commissioner Donna Ledwin. "Her presentations are always up to date on the latest interpretations and applications, and she just gets to the point. Everyone leaves better informed with practical ideas on how to make their programs better when it comes to gender equity."
Judge, an attorney with Holland & Knight, a Boston-based law firm, covered both gender equity and sexual harrassment and assault in her presentation.
